Bomb threat closes Avenue 12 in Madera Ranchos
A bomb threat closed Avenue 12 in the Madera Ranchos for about 90 minutes on Wednesday while sheriff’s deputies investigated a suspicious device.
“The device looked very real but turned out to be a dummy,” said Lt. Bill Ward with the Madera County Sheriff’s Office.
The CHP closed Avenue 12 between Road 36 and Road 37 1/2 as part of the investigation, which began around 2 p.m. and ended at 3:30 p.m.
